In addition to connecting players, online gaming has created an entirely new industry: esports. Professional gaming competitions have skyrocketed in popularity, with millions of viewers tuning in to watch the world’s best players compete for cash prizes and prestige. Esports tournaments, such as those held for games like Dota 2, Counter-Strike, and Overwatch, have become major events, drawing in large audiences both in person and online. Esports has become a professional career path for many, with players, teams, and coaches becoming celebrities in their own right. The rise of esports has also led to the creation of collegiate programs, sponsorships, and media coverage, further legitimizing gaming as a sport in the eyes of the public.

The accessibility of online gaming has also played a significant role in its growth. With the advent of mobile gaming, people no longer need to own expensive gaming consoles or PCs to participate in the online gaming world. Games like PUBG Mobile, Candy Crush, and Clash Royale have made gaming accessible to a wider audience, including those who do not identify as traditional gamers. The mobile gaming market has become one of the largest sectors of the industry, contributing significantly to the global reach of online gaming. Furthermore, free-to-play models have lowered the entry barriers, allowing anyone with a smartphone or computer to start playing without a financial commitment.
